**Ticket: Migrate nightly cron jobs to Trellisflow**

We are moving the remaining cron jobs on the Ostara batch host into the Trellisflow workflow engine. For security review: each migrated job now runs under a scoped service account instead of the shared scheduler user, secrets are injected at runtime rather than baked into crontabs, and audit logging covers every task transition. No job retains shell access to the legacy host. The staging run that exercised all twelve workflows emitted the trace token shown below.

build token for yajof-bajof: htk31_506ff1188f74596b5bb2eec94edc43c

### Retry failed exports (Ledgerbird)

This PR adds automatic retries for export jobs that fail with transient errors from the Farrow warehouse. Failures are classified; only retryable codes re-enqueue, with exponential backoff and jitter to avoid thundering herds after an outage. Permanent failures still alert immediately. Dead-lettered jobs now carry the full attempt history for debugging. The backoff schedule and caps we're proposing for the sync review are as follows.

constants for bagaf-hadup:
QUOTAS = {
    "quenael": 1,
    "ralwyn": 1,
    "oliath": 2,
    "ulaael": 2,
}

Quarterly Planning Note — Tavrin Pilot Churn

For the finance team: churn in the Tavrin pilot reached 11% this quarter, above the 7% model assumption. Exit interviews point to onboarding friction rather than pricing. Revenue impact is contained within existing contingency. We will rerun forecasts once the cohort stabilises. The confidential implications for next year's plans are summarised below.

board note of bawep-tajef: Queniusek Systems plans to raise the Quenvan list price by 53.1 percent in March. The pricing group signed off on a budget of $176.4 million for Project Drueth. The renewal with Casionix Partners closes at $142.5 million a year, 8.3 percent below the last contract. Project Fraax slips by six weeks because of the tooling delay.